UCPH's sustainability targets and actions

The University of Copenhagen has approved targets for environmental sustainability in 2030 in six main areas:

Sustainability

Climate

  • Reduce overall climate footprint (Scope 1-3 carbon footprint) per full-time equivalent (FTE) by 50% in 2030. 

Chemistry

  • Prioritise products and solutions without health and environmental contaminants in procurement, operations and construction.
  • Reduce the use of environmentally and health hazardous substances in teaching and research.

Involvement, participation and behaviour

  • Offer good opportunities to practise sustainable behaviour in day-to-day life at UCPH.
  • Opportunity for staff and students to engage in specific initiatives and actions aimed at the development of a more sustainable UCPH.

Biodiversity

  • Examine the areas in which UCPH’s activities have the greatest impact on biodiversity and, on this basis, develop specific goals, targets, initiatives and actions for UCPH as an institution.

Resources and Recycling

  • More sustainable procurement, use and recycling of resources that contribute to a significant reduction in UCPH’s resource consumption
  • Recycling of 60% of waste 
  • Reduce total quantities for incineration and landfills by 50% per FTE

Collaboration and global knowledge sharing

  • Engage nationally and globally in the sustainability work
  • Continue to be internationally recognised for its sustainability work.
